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
39 10 835694772 6394 65573922013
934494 1277436898 08711074826
934494 1277436898 08711074826
3542925588 8513885019 85
All about undefined
Interested in learning more?
934494 1277436898 08711074826
3542925588 8513885019 85
See more
94220659 15821 52989076
604653 946521 411982411 52
See more
4112126 52426 9974404
25 708805434 32931 42419
See more